Study of Polymorphism Rs4612666 in NLRP3 Gene in Patients with Type 2 Diabetes in East Azerbaijan

Introduction: Type 2 diabetes is a common multifactorial disease. Studies have shown that the NLRP3 gene plays an important role in insulin resistance. The aim of this study was to investigate the association of rs4612666 polymorphisms of NLRp3 gene with type 2 diabetes in the population of East Azarbaijan province.
